Is there any real difference in using some regular 80w-90 Gear Lube like the Penzoil in the yellow bottle versus one marketed specifically for marine lower units?

I've used it for the past 25 years with no problems. Got the idea when I noticed the local boat dealer filling one out of a 120# drum of automotive gear oil. I'm sure a lot of dealers would tell you no, but it has the same specs as lower unit oil. I have asked several marine mechanics and no one could give me a good reason not to. Like I said, it works.
